On Monday, October 19, 2020 at 7:13:37 PM UTC-7, wrote: I recently found this on the Jakarta Soaring web page. Shows a highly modified 2-22 turned into a single-seat powered aircraft. http://jakartasoaringclub.tripod.com...bondol001.html But why? Back in the 90's there was a Breezy flying with 2-22 wings with a pusher engine at Dillingham in Hawaii. Frame was moly tubing, seating was tandem without anything except a seat and seat belt. Was built by Sam Bleadon. Indeed it was Breezy and felt like you were flying a broom stick. The main wing was well behind the pilot. Buzz |
